黑狐家游戏

数据库中字典是啥意思,数据库数据字典,揭秘数据库背后的秘密武器

欧气 0 0

本文目录导读:

  1. 什么是数据字典?
  2. 数据字典的作用
  3. 数据字典的组成
  4. 数据字典的实现

数据库,作为现代信息社会的基础设施,已经渗透到各行各业,对于数据库中的一些核心概念,如数据字典,很多人可能并不十分了解,本文将带您走进数据库的世界,揭秘数据字典的奥秘。

什么是数据字典?

数据字典,顾名思义,就是关于数据库中数据的描述,它详细记录了数据库中所有表、字段、视图、索引等对象的名称、类型、长度、默认值等信息,数据字典就是数据库的“说明书”,帮助我们更好地理解和使用数据库。

数据字典的作用

1、管理数据库结构

数据字典记录了数据库中所有表、字段、视图等对象的定义,使得数据库管理员可以轻松地了解数据库的结构,方便对其进行维护和管理。

数据库中字典是啥意思,数据库数据字典,揭秘数据库背后的秘密武器

图片来源于网络,如有侵权联系删除

2、保障数据一致性

数据字典规定了各个字段的类型、长度、默认值等属性,有助于保证数据在存储、查询、更新等操作过程中的准确性,确保数据的一致性。

3、促进数据共享

数据字典为数据库中的数据提供了统一的描述,有助于实现数据在不同系统、不同部门之间的共享,提高数据利用率。

4、提高开发效率

在数据库开发过程中,数据字典可以帮助开发者快速了解数据库结构,减少对数据库的查询和修改,提高开发效率。

5、便于故障排查

当数据库出现问题时,数据字典可以帮助数据库管理员快速定位问题所在,提高故障排查效率。

数据字典的组成

1、表信息

数据库中字典是啥意思,数据库数据字典,揭秘数据库背后的秘密武器

图片来源于网络,如有侵权联系删除

表信息包括表名、字段名、字段类型、长度、默认值、是否允许空值、主键、外键等。

2、字段信息

字段信息包括字段名、字段类型、长度、默认值、是否允许空值、主键、外键等。

3、视图信息

视图信息包括视图名、查询语句、创建时间、修改时间等。

4、索引信息

索引信息包括索引名、索引类型、字段名、排序方式等。

5、存储过程信息

存储过程信息包括存储过程名、创建时间、修改时间、参数列表、返回值等。

数据库中字典是啥意思,数据库数据字典,揭秘数据库背后的秘密武器

图片来源于网络,如有侵权联系删除

数据字典的实现

数据字典的实现方式有很多种,以下列举几种常见的方法:

1、手动创建

数据库管理员可以手动创建数据字典,将数据库中的表、字段、视图等对象的定义记录下来。

2、使用数据库工具

一些数据库工具(如Navicat、DBeaver等)可以帮助数据库管理员自动生成数据字典。

3、开发自定义工具

开发人员可以根据实际需求,开发自定义工具生成数据字典。

数据字典是数据库的重要组成部分,它为数据库管理员和开发者提供了强大的支持,通过了解数据字典,我们可以更好地管理和使用数据库,提高工作效率,希望本文能帮助您揭开数据字典的神秘面纱,为您的数据库之旅增添一份助力。

标签: #数据库数据字典是什么意思

黑狐家游戏
  • 评论列表

留言评论